摘要
A novel control scheme has been developed in this work that combines the multirate technique and iterative learning control (ILC). The multirate technique produces a faster sampling rate by means of an estimator, which assists the ILC scheme to better perform in achieving perfect tracking along the iteration axis. We first show the multirate and ILC design. Then the multirate estimator and ILC are unified both in a fixed sampling rate, in order to facilitate control system analysis. In the sequel the characteristics of multirate estimator, ILC and the synergy are analyzed respectively. Subsequently, the new scheme is applied to and verified by a Ball-and-Beam system.
